Understanding Ball Joints
Before we dive into the specifics of how many ball joints a car has, it’s essential to understand what a ball joint is and its role in the vehicle’s suspension system. A ball joint is a type of joint that allows for rotational movement in almost every direction. It consists of a ball and socket design, where the ball is attached to the control arm, and the socket is connected to the steering knuckle. This configuration enables the smooth movement of the wheels over bumps and during turns, facilitating the necessary flexibility for steering and suspension travel.
Function and Importance
The primary function of a ball joint is to act as a pivot point between the suspension control arms and the steering knuckles, allowing for the vertical movement of the suspension as it travels over road irregularities. This flexibility is crucial for maintaining tire contact with the road, which affects traction, handling, and safety. Worn-out or damaged ball joints can lead to a range of issues, including uneven tire wear, vibrations in the steering wheel, and decreased vehicle stability, highlighting the importance of these components in maintaining the overall performance and safety of the vehicle.

Configuration of Ball Joints in Vehicles
Now, addressing the question of how many ball joints a car typically has, we must consider the vehicle’s design and suspension type. Most vehicles have a front suspension that includes ball joints. For a standard front-wheel-drive vehicle with an independent front suspension (such as MacPherson struts or control arms), there are usually two ball joints per side. This means a total of four ball joints for the front suspension alone, with two located on the driver’s side and two on the passenger’s side.
Rear Suspension Considerations
In the rear, the suspension design varies more widely among different models and manufacturers. Some vehicles, especially those with independent rear suspensions, may also include ball joints, while others might use different types of joints or bushings. However, the question of four ball joints primarily pertains to the front suspension, as the rear suspension’s configuration can differ significantly.
Special Considerations for Certain Vehicles
Certain vehicles, especially those designed for heavy-duty use or with specific suspension designs (like solid axles), may have different configurations. For example, a vehicle with a solid rear axle might not have ball joints in the rear suspension at all, instead relying on leaf springs, shock absorbers, and other components to manage movement and loads.

What are the symptoms of worn-out ball joints, and how can they be identified?
Worn-out ball joints can exhibit a range of symptoms, including clunking or snapping noises, vibrations, and looseness in the suspension. As the ball joints deteriorate, they can cause the vehicle to pull to one side, and the steering may become less responsive. Additionally, uneven tire wear, such as premature wear on the inner or outer edges of the tires, can be a sign of worn-out ball joints. In severe cases, the ball joints can fail completely, leading to a loss of control and potentially causing an accident.
To identify worn-out ball joints, car owners can perform a simple test by bouncing the vehicle up and down and listening for any unusual noises. A clunking or snapping sound typically indicates worn-out ball joints. A visual inspection can also reveal signs of wear, such as rust, corrosion, or physical damage to the ball joints. Furthermore, a professional mechanic can use specialized tools to inspect the ball joints and determine the extent of the wear. By recognizing the symptoms of worn-out ball joints, car owners can take proactive measures to address the issue and prevent more severe problems from developing.

What is the average lifespan of ball joints, and how can their lifespan be extended?
The average lifespan of ball joints varies depending on the vehicle, driving conditions, and maintenance habits. Typically, ball joints can last between 70,000 to 150,000 miles, although some may need replacement earlier or later. Factors such as driving style, road conditions, and suspension maintenance can significantly impact the lifespan of the ball joints. Regular lubrication, inspection, and maintenance of the suspension system can help extend the lifespan of the ball joints.
To extend the lifespan of ball joints, car owners can take several proactive measures, including regular lubrication of the suspension components, avoiding extreme driving habits, and maintaining proper tire pressure. Additionally, addressing any issues with the suspension system promptly, such as worn-out shocks or struts, can help reduce the stress and strain on the ball joints. By taking a proactive approach to suspension maintenance, car owners can help extend the lifespan of the ball joints and prevent premature wear and tear. Regular inspections and maintenance can also help identify potential issues before they become major problems, ensuring the overall safety and reliability of the vehicle.
